An object is projected from the ground with an initial velocity of 24.5 m/s at 30o above the horizontal.

Find the (a) horizontal and vertical components of its initial velocity, (b) time to reach the maximum

height, (c) time of flight, (d) maximum height attained by the object, (e) speed at the maximum height,

(f) range, and the (g) velocity upon striking the ground.
